Output 28ba50e4d66b215566307ca9a94209811760df260bf1e1531c02f9dd48c03836:0

value
183760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dccd800d2bad4da2e4f41a586df0be031babd47a OP_EQUAL
address
MU2f537GBBaFhruYfnyptZA4WG1djmDj2R
transaction
28ba50e4d66b215566307ca9a94209811760df260bf1e1531c02f9dd48c03836
spent
true